About Mrs. Beynon

Genoa-Kingston High School Art Department will have engaged and focused students that utilize technology to collaborate in and out of the classroom, as well as communicate with a technological focus in the Fine arts, based on art history, and ever-improving techniques and materials that are growing and changing in our 21st Century.

 

Lisa Beynon started her artistic career at age 3, painting princesses, and drawing clothing for as long as her parents would allow. Growing up in the city of Chicago and attending Lane Technical High School gave her a fabulous foundation in art. During high school it was required to pick an area of concentration. The obvious choice for Lisa, was art. This led to a B.S. in Art Education degree from Northern Illinois University. Mrs. Beynon student taught at Genoa-Kingston High School, and was immediately drawn to the loving community, and small town pride. Lisa was fortunate enough to obtain a full time teaching position at the school she loved, GKHS, and has worked there for the past 17 years, and counting.
